6. Kickstarter – The OG Platform

Kickstarter has funded over 271,000 projects with billions in pledges. You only get money if you hit your goal, but when backers support you, they're pre-ordering your product.

Once funded and delivered, you've got a product you can continue selling—turning Kickstarter into long-term income. Board games, tech gadgets, and independent films all get funded here regularly.

7. Indiegogo – Keep What You Raise

Unlike Kickstarter, Indiegogo lets you keep whatever you raise even if you don't meet your goal. I've personally backed products here, which tells you people actively spend money on this platform.

9. Crowdcube – Equity Crowdfunding

Investors get actual shares in your business. Popular in the UK and US, it's perfect for startups needing serious backing. Your investors want you to succeed because they own a piece of it—meaning advice, connections, and support beyond just cash.
